Open Meetings
Your Profile

Gypsies Green Stadium

South Shields, United Kingdom

0 Meetings

Used By

Logo

South Shields Harriers & AC

South Shields, United Kingdom

See Details

Track Location

Gypsies Green Stadium, Baring Street, South Shields, Tyne & Wear, NE33 2BB, United Kingdom